The Origins of the Surname Rovis

The surname Rovis is believed to have originated from Italy, specifically from the northern region of Lombardy. The name Rovis is derived from the Italian word "rovo," which means "bramble" or "thornbush." This suggests that the original bearers of the surname may have lived near a thorny or brambly area, or perhaps worked as gatherers of wild berries.

Rovis around the World

Interestingly, the surname Rovis is not limited to Italy, as it is also found in other countries around the world. With significant incidences in Colombia (107 occurrences) and Croatia (100 occurrences), it is evident that the name has traveled far beyond its Italian origins. The presence of Rovis in countries such as France, Portugal, the United States, Brazil, and Greece further suggests that the name has spread globally, potentially through migration or relocation of families.

In countries like Australia, India, and England, the surname Rovis is less common, with lower incidences of 20, 7, and 5 respectively.
